NEW AIRLINE - Mada Airways, almost ready to launch
The first local airline to be created since Middle East Airlines (MEA) was granted its monopoly in 1969 plans to operate exclusively from Rene Moawad Airport in Qleiaat after its rehabilitation.
A new Lebanese airline is preparing to enter the market: Mada Airways, the sister company of IBEX Air Charter, a private jet and charter flight operator based in Beirut and Congo. The carrier is awaiting its license and the rehabilitation of Rene Moawad Airport in Qleiaat, Akkar, to launch operations.Mada Airways plans to move into scheduled commercial aviation and to operate exclusively from the northern airport.This development comes as Lebanon’s aviation market enters a new phase, following the expiry of Middle East Airlines' (MEA) long-standing exclusivity agreement earlier this year, which had granted the national carrier a monopoly over the local market since 1969
The airline is expected to begin operations with Airbus A320 aircraft and target budget-conscious travelers
